Transaction 2e52258f712402252a5aa947ac90be7a3eb70bddc45326360e79d65876ab2d71

1 Input
2 Outputs
  • 2e52258f712402252a5aa947ac90be7a3eb70bddc45326360e79d65876ab2d71:0
  • value  1423602
    address  34pFk2WZFU3t3PmHN3iwcxM2NuVRHHGuBT
  • 2e52258f712402252a5aa947ac90be7a3eb70bddc45326360e79d65876ab2d71:1
  • value  921605492
    address  17LmwYLQ3Yp3tGxsSk25TaJH1t5QdJmt19